COMING SOON: Tropical Sim KDCA

Thats right!!! Tropical Sim has announce there next project will be a airport within the USA. Ronald Reagan Washington National Airport (KDCA) for FS9, FSX, and P3D. No images posted yet, but estimated release date is before Christmas.



UPDATE: UK2000's East Midlands

Gary from UK2000 has posted several "early" images of his next scenery release. East Midland Airport (EGNX) for FSX and FS9. Gary also states that there will not be any new images till sometime in January.



RELEASED: Orbx/FTX Harvey Field

Orbx/FTX has announced the release of Harvey Field (S43) for FSX. 
This small airfield is Located in Snohomish, Washington. 
This is the 6th of 8 back to back releases this holiday season.
